To celebrate the DVD release, here is our review of Stag Night Of The Dead! Review by Lucy Pitt. There's an area in Birmingham called Newtown, which is not dissimilar to the New Town portrayed in brilliant Zombie film Stag Night Of The Dead – apart from the stun guns, but I bet it won't